One thing I have learned since being here is more about the art of “Kintsugi” (or “golden joinery” by translation), 

This is the Japanese art of repainting broken pottery with lacquer mixed with powdered gold, silver or platinum, so highlighting the cracks as part of the life and beauty of the object. 

Kintsugi showcases the “flaws” and “imperfections” instead of hiding them.
